2. What is Generative Engine Optimization (GEO)?

GEO defined

GEO is the practice of preparing content, metadata, and signals so generative models and hybrid search assistants can find, trust, and use your content as a direct answer. GEO includes prompt-aware formatting, data provenance, structured snippets, and response-ready microcontent.

Core components of GEO

GEO relies on structured data (schema), canonical knowledge nodes, clear authorship, and short answer units that map to common user intents. It also includes safe, verifiable update channels so models can refresh knowledge without incorporating stale or inaccurate data.

GEO vs. prompt engineering

Prompt engineering is how consumers coerce models to return desired outputs. GEO is the publisher-side discipline of ensuring your content surfaces when a model executes a prompt — through good structure, authoritative signal, and metadata optimized to be quoted or summarized.

5. Measuring GEO vs. Traditional SEO Performance

New KPIs to track

Beyond clicks and impressions, track citation rate (how often your domain is used as a source by assistants), answer-to-click ratio, and snippet retention. Log API requests for citations where possible; these are emerging leading indicators for GEO ROI.

Experimentation framework

Set up A/B tests for answer-ready microcontent: short, factual paragraphs formatted for extraction vs. long-form content. Use server-side or CDN experiments to measure whether specific formatting increases citation or inclusion in synthesized responses.

Instrumentation and data hygiene

7. Content Strategy: How to Write for GEO and Humans

Write layered content

Design pages with a pyramid structure: immediate answer (40–120 words), quick bullets (3–7 items), and long-form supporting sections. This provides both extractable answers for GEO and depth for human readers and traditional rankings.

Use canonical facts and microcopy

11. Comparison Table: GEO vs. Traditional SEO

Dimension GEO Traditional SEO
Primary Output Concise, synthesized answers and citations Search result listings, organic traffic
Key Signals Provenance, structured data, live APIs Backlinks, on-page relevance, site authority
Measurement Citation rate, answer-to-click, API pulls Impressions, clicks, rankings, CTR
Update Cadence Requires frequent verification and feeds Periodic content updates, crawling cycles
Best Use Cases FAQs, product specs, local facts, definitions Evergreen guides, topical authority, keyword niches
Risk Potential for misattribution or hallucination Loss of rankings to algorithm updates

FAQ: Common questions about GEO and Traditional SEO

Q1: Will GEO replace traditional SEO?

A1: Not completely. GEO changes how answers are surfaced, but traditional SEO's technical foundations, backlink authority, and content depth remain essential. Treat GEO as a complementary layer — a new signal pipeline.

Q2: How do I prioritize pages for GEO?

A2: Start with pages that answer transactional or high-frequency questions (product specs, pricing, local availability, FAQs). Convert those into short, fact-first formats with structured data.

Q3: What are quick wins for local businesses?

A3: Ensure consistent NAP, verify business listings, supply feeds for inventory and hours, and publish succinct answer cards for common customer questions. See local retail strategies for more ideas.

Q4: How can I prevent generative models from misusing my content?

A4: Provide authoritative metadata and correction channels, use machine-readable disclaimers where necessary, and maintain logs to prove your publish history. Also, institute editorial QA focused on verifiability.

Q5: What metrics prove GEO success?

A5: Citation rate, answer-to-click ratio, changes in branded leads from assistant channels, and reduction in misattribution incidents are the best early signals.
